Google Sync Allows You to Synchronise Your iPhone, Windows Mobile Devices and SyncML phones

This Google Sync allows your iPhone, Windows Mobile devices or SyncML phones to synchronise Gmail contacts and Google calendar to your phone.

To me, it is like ActiveSync. In fact, Google had mentioned that they are actually user Microsoft Exchange Active Sync to accomplish the synchronisation. BTW, be careful before synchronisation. Ensure that you have backup your data. This is the same warning that Google had given before you synchronise.

Not all contacts in Gmail are synchronised. Only those in My Contacts are synchronise. That means if you have an Exchange Server to synchronise your emails or contacts, you would probably NOT able to use this service.

To add to My Contact, follow the below instruction:

  • Click on Contacts on your Gmail
  • Select the contacts that you wish to shift to My Contacts
  • Click “Move to My Contacts”
  • That is it!
